New Delhi: TVK chief C Joseph Vijay was sworn in on Sunday Chief Minister of Tamil Nadu His party is the single largest in the assembly after the May 4 verdict. He was sworn in after days of fighting to prove his majority to Governor Rajendra Vishwanath Arlekar.He took oath at the Jawaharlal Nehru Stadium in Chennai.The governor directed actor-politician Vijay to seek a vote of confidence in the assembly on or before May 13.

Vijay’s TV has stormed the Tamil Nadu elections, shattering its traditional strength Dravidian Munnetra Kazgam and the all-India Anna Dravida Munnetra Kazhagam, a 50-year-old dominant in state politics.The victory was successful MK Stalin As Chief Minister of Tamil Nadu.Viduthalai Chiruthaigal Kachi and the Indian Union Muslim League extended unconditional support to TVK on Saturday, helping Vijay reach the required majority of 120 in the 234-member assembly. The Congress, CPI and CPM had already supported TV, taking its tally to 116 from 107 by Friday night. With the addition of VCK and IUML, the number rose to 120.
